By Cindy McLennan | Season 2 | Episode 8 | Aired on 11.25.2012

Oh, cute. It's a little holiday spot. In all their royal finery, Charming dances with Snow and says, "Let it Snow. Let it Snow. Let it Snow." She smiles up at him and says, "Charming." And as cavity inducing as that is, it's still a million times more watchable than that stupid Brad Pitt/Chanel No. 5 commercial. Am I right?

Storybrooke. Henry tries to encourage Charming to wake and asks Regina if he should be under so long. She tells Henry she's sure it's fine and that they're just catching up, but when the boy turns his back, she gives Rumpy a knowing yet concerned look. We flash sideways to...

The Land of One Pathetic Poppy. Snow wakes in a panic, frantically searching for more sleeping powder. As Emma tries to talk her mother down, Snow explains the situation with Charming. Finally, it is Emma's faith that calms Snow enough so that she tells Emma the key to stopping Rumpy is in his jail cell. As the ladies start off, Emma realizes her compass is gone, as is Mulan.

Running through the forest, compass in hand, we see Mulan, the treacherous.

Neverland. Cora is surprised to see Hook in Aurora's prison. They sneer at each other Cora magics him up against a wall, muttering about his death wish. Grabbing his hook, she rubs it against his hairy chest, and thank goodness our rogue isn't waxed as smooth as a baby's bottom because that would just be wrong. Cora says she has to kill him now, but Hook suggests she thank him instead, and tells her he's brought her a gift. It's in his satchel. When Cora opens the bag, she gasps and looks up at Hook. "Is that?" Hook: "Indeed it is, and with it, you'll get everything you want."

Emma and Snow finally catch up with Mulan. Armed with her trusty bow and arrow, Snow makes it clear she'll use it if need be. Emma reminds Mulan that all they want is the compass. Mulan makes like she's going to comply, but then draws her sword. Fisticuffs ensue. Snow gets on top of Mulan and, holding an arrow to her neck, explains that they've found what they've needed to best Cora. Mulan says something disparaging about, "Another journey," so she must have watched Lost, too, which is a pretty good idea when you're stuck in time for 28 years. Just as Snow is about to use the arrow on Mulan, Aurora finds them and orders them to free Mulan.

When she's asked if she was followed, Aurora says she doesn't think so. While Cora probably knows she's gone by now, she escaped undetected. Emma asks how she did escape. Aurora: "It was Hook, het let me go. [...] Because of you. He said he wanted to prove to you that you should have trusted him. That if you had trusted him, you could have..." We cut to...
